Saraki begs ASUU to end strike

Date: 2009-08-02

Kwara State Governor, Dr Bukola Saraki has appealed to members of the Academic Staff Union of Universities (ASUU) currently on strike to return to the negotiation table with a view to resolving the trade dispute between the union and the Federal Government.

Governor Saraki made the appeal on Wednesday when the Vice Chancellor and members of the Governing Council of the University of Abuja paid him a courtesy visit in his office at Government House, Ilorin.

He specially enjoined the Federal Government and the striking University lecturers to go back to the drawing board to address the grey areas in the interest of the innocent students who have suffered untold hardship.

Saraki, who also advocated a critical review of the nation’s University system called for its proper funding to make them meet contemporary global challenges.

He noted with dismay that University system in Nigeria was faced with a lot of challenges that needs to be addressed urgently to salvage University education system from collapse.

He praised authorities of the University of Abuja for giving preference to indigenes of the State origin in its admission policy and staff recruitment and appealed for their upward review to give opportunity to more Kwara indigenes.

The Governor, however, assured the delegation of the readiness of his government to continue to assist the University in addressing some of its developmental needs to ensure full realisation of its aspirations.

Earlier, the leader of the delegation and Vice Chancellor of the University, Professor James Adelabu explained that the Uinversity was established in 1988 to encourage advancement of learning, acquire liberal and higher education and undertake distance and continuous learning, among others.

Prof. Adelabu said the objectives of the University could only be realised with the support of governors in the country to move the nation’s University education forward.

He solicited Dr Saraki’s support to transform the institution and assured of collaboration between the University of Abuja and the newly established Kwara State University to fast track its growth and development.
